    Since your roof is continually subjected to the outside elements, this means your roof is going to deteriorate gradually. The pace at which it deteriorates will be dependent on a variety of variables. Those include; the quality of the initial materials that were used as well as the workm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is preserved and the type of roof. Most roofing contractors will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but obviously that can never be guaranteed due to the above factors. Our advice is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ular roof in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You should never pressure-wash your roof, as you take the risk of washing away any covering materials that have been included to offer protection from the weather. Furthermore, you should steer clear of chlorine-based bleach cleaning products since they can easily also diminish the life-span of your roof. When you speak to your roof cleaning specialist, ask them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will clear away the unsightly algae and staining without damaging the tile or shingles.

    More About Brooksville

    Brooksville is a city in and the county seat of Hernando County, Florida, United States.[7] As of the 2010 census it had a population of 7,719,[3] up from 7,264 at the 2000 census. Brooksville is home to historic buildings and residences, including the homes of former Florida Governor William Sherman Jennings and football player Jerome Brown. It is part of the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, Florida Metropolitan Statistical Area.

    Brooksville, established in 1856 by the merger of the towns of Melendez and Pierceville, took its name to honor and show support for Preston Brooks, a pro-slavery congressman from South Carolina who caned and seriously injured Massachusetts Senator and abolitionist Charles Sumner.

    How To Choose A Reliable Roofing Company For Your Residence

    fix-roof-leak-in
    The primary purpose of the roof is to shelter you and the family through the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Having a well-maintained roof is vital if you want to build a home which is safe and comfy.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s need to be repaired or replaced at one point or any other. Unless you have the right tools and experience to do the job yourself, that generally means getting a professional roofing contractor.

    The importance of hiring the correct company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ects can be expensive. You should know you are investing your hard earned dollars wisely and that the finished roof may last for a long time to come. Check out these guidelines on how to look for a reliable roofing contractor for your home:

    1. Utilize a local company. Prior to hiring a contractor, be sure that they have a physical address in your city or county. Local contractors are more likely to know about the codes and building requirements in your area. They are also unlikely to try to scam you from the money since they have to maintain their reputation in your neighborhood.

    2. Verify that this cont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always make time to get licensed. You should certainly check out licensing information online from the website of your respective city or state. Check to make sure that the contractor’s license applies and that it is current prior to hiring them. Additionally, ask the contractor to deliver evidence of ins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they start work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t create the mistake of hiring the very first company that you contact. Instead, get in touch with a minimum of some different contractors in your neighborhood to obtain quotes for the roofing project. Ask each contractor to present you with an itemized quote to help you see just where your money is going. Ideally, they should send an agent to the property to evaluate the roof directly before giving you a quote. Doing this, the estimate they supply will be a lot more accurate.

    4. Be sure the clients are trustworthy by reading through reviews from their past clients. Consider checking with groups just like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to make sure that that no major complaints happen to be filed against them.

    5. Get everything in writing. Don’t simply take a contractor at their word. Instead, ask them to provide you with a written contract. Make sure both you and the contractor sign the agreement. Have a copy on your own in the event that any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the chance of misunderstandings and gives you legal protection if the contractor fails to go by through on their promises.

    Choosing a reliable roofing company for your home is really important. Your roof is amongst the most essential components of your property. Employing a professional roofing company who may have a fantastic reputation is the best way to ensure that the project goes as planned.
